2012 Oddset Hockey Games


The 2012 Oddset Hockey Games was played between 9–12 February 2012. The Czech Republic, Finland, Sweden and Russia played a round-robin for a total of three games per team and six games in total. Five of the matches were played in the Ericsson Globe in Stockholm, Sweden, and one match in the Helsinki Olympic Stadium in Helsinki, Finland. Sweden won the tournament for the second year in a row, after defeating Finland 3–1 on the last game day. The tournament was part of Euro Hockey Tour 2011–12.
Prior to this year, Sweden Hockey Games was named LG Hockey Games because the tournament was sponsored by LG Electronics. However, after LG decided to drop out their sponsoring, Oddset, a gambling game by Svenska Spel, took over and effectively renamed the tournament to Oddset Hockey Games.

Tournament awards

Tournament All-Star Team selected by the media:

Goaltender: Viktor Fasth

Defencemen: Ossi Väänänen, Mattias Ekholm

Forwards: Juhamatti Aaltonen, Evgeny Kuznetsov, Nicklas Danielsson
